11 Sandwiches That Deserve Their Own Holiday
Some sandwiches are so legendary, they should be celebrated with a holiday of their own. These eleven all-stars are creative, comforting, and unforgettable;worthy of being honored by sandwich lovers everywhere. Mark your calendar for these must-try bites.
Fullfernutter Sandwich

Peanut butter and marshmallow fluff on white bread. Sticky, sweet, and a nostalgic treat that deserves a day in its honor.
Crab Cake Sandwich

Golden crab cake, crisp lettuce, and creamy sauce on a soft bun. Coastal comfort worth a parade.
Chicken Bacon Ranch Sliders

Crispy chicken, smoky bacon, creamy ranch, and soft slider buns. These mini sandwiches are party-ready and unforgettable.
Loose Meat Sandwich

Seasoned ground beef crumbled in a hamburger bun. Simple and hearty enough to win over any crowd.
Fried Pork Tenderloin Sandwich

Giant, crispy pork tenderloin spilling out of a bun. A Midwestern favorite you’ll celebrate every time you find it.
North Shore Beef

Thinly sliced roast beef piled high and dipped in savory jus. Massachusetts’ pride and joy, always worth the hype.
Albuquerque Turkey Sandwich

Roasted turkey, green chiles, cheese, and grilled bread. The Southwest’s spicy twist on deli comfort food.
Patty Melt

Ground beef, Swiss, and caramelized onions grilled on rye. An American classic that deserves a spot in sandwich history.
Liver Mush Sandwich

Fried slices of savory liver mush, mustard, and white bread. North Carolina’s unique bite is ready for its own festival.
Pepperoni Rolls

Soft, doughy roll stuffed with pepperoni. West Virginia’s original and a celebration in every bite.
Fried Bologna Sandwich

Thick-cut bologna crisped up and layered on white bread. It’s simple, humble, and deserves a day of honor.
